The role of a cosmetic dentist

While a general dentist focuses on helping a patient have healthy, strong teeth and gums, a cosmetic professional takes it a step further. These dentists provide solutions to enhance a person’s smile. These professionals can use various methods to restore a tooth’s function and improve a person’s facial appearance. The cosmetic dentist may work closely with the general dentist in some circumstances.

Various treatments

The cosmetic dentist should be a person’s first choice to repair severely damaged teeth. This dentist can also get rid of blemishes. These treatments can be effective at restoring bites and helping the person feel more comfortable about being in social situations. Some of these methods include:

  • Teeth whitening
  • Crowns
  • Veneers
  • Bridges
  • Dental implants
  • Dentures

Making the right decision

Some people may have difficulty knowing which treatment will be most effective to correct the cosmetic or functional issue. If the person is missing teeth, a cosmetic dentist can recommend either implants, bridges or dentures. A crown or veneer may be most effective at repairing a crack or chip. For teeth whitening, the dentist can suggest either an in-office treatment or take-home products. At an appointment, the dental staff will discuss the benefits and drawbacks of each option. This will enable the patient to make a choice everyone can feel good about.

Qualities of a cosmetic dentist

A cosmetic dentist has additional years of training and study beyond regular dental school requirements. This professional will also commit to continuing education and has practical application of key cosmetic procedures. Also, the right dental professional has good customer service skills and knows how to listen carefully to the patient’s needs and concerns.
